Tracksuit has created beautiful, always-on, and radically affordable brand tracking for modern consumer brands. Brand marketers and leaders at consumer brands have access to enterprise-tier brand tracking, specifically built for them, at a price point that works. Teams can easily track awareness, consideration, preference and brand associations from real humans within the wider market, and compare results against competitors.
